Rev. 9:1–12

1The fifth angel sounded, and I saw a star from the sky which had fallen to the earth. The key to the pit of the abyss was given to him.
2He opened the pit of the abyss, and smoke went up out of the pit, like the smoke from a burning furnace. The sun and the air were darkened because of the smoke from the pit.
3Then out of the smoke came locusts on the earth, and power was given to them, as the scorpions of the earth have power.
4They were told that they should not hurt the grass of the earth, neither any green thing, neither any tree, but only those people who don’t have God’s seal on their foreheads.
5They were given power, not to kill them, but to torment them for five months. Their torment was like the torment of a scorpion, when it strikes a person.
6In those days people will seek death, and will in no way find it. They will desire to die, and death will flee from them.
7The shapes of the locusts were like horses prepared for war. On their heads were something like golden crowns, and their faces were like people’s faces.
8They had hair like women’s hair, and their teeth were like those of lions.
9They had breastplates, like breastplates of iron. The sound of their wings was like the sound of chariots, or of many horses rushing to war.
10They have tails like those of scorpions, and stings. In their tails they have power to harm men for five months.
11They have over them as king the angel of the abyss. His name in Hebrew is “Abaddon”, but in Greek, he has the name “Apollyon”.

12The first woe is past. Behold, there are still two woes coming after this.
